Sec. 36.181. APPROVAL BY ATTORNEY GENERAL; REGISTRATION BY COMPTROLLER.

(a)Bonds and notes issued by a district must be submitted to the attorney general for examination.
(b)If the attorney general finds that the bonds or notes have been authorized in accordance with law, the attorney general shall approve them, and they shall be registered by the comptroller.
(c)After the approval and registration of bonds or notes, the bonds or notes are incontestable in any court or other forum, for any reason, and are valid and binding obligations in accordance with their terms for all purposes. SUBCHAPTER G. DISTRICT REVENUES

Legislative History

Added by Acts 1995, 74th Leg., ch. 933, Sec. 2, eff. Sept. 1, 1995.
